VPS系统安装包有哪些?_全面解析常用系统安装包及选择指南

VPS系统安装包有哪些选择?

系统类型 常用安装包 适用场景 特点
Linux发行版 Ubuntu、CentOS、Debian 网站托管、应用部署 开源免费、稳定性强
Windows Server Windows Server 20192022 ASP.NET应用、远程桌面 图形界面、易用性强
控制面板 cPanel、Plesk、Webmin 网站管理、虚拟主机 可视化操作、功能全面
应用环境 LAMP、LNMP、WAMP Web服务环境 一键部署、快速搭建

VPS系统安装包全面解析

VPS系统安装包是搭建服务器环境的基础组件,选择合适的安装包能显著提高服务器部署效率和管理便利性。

主要系统安装包类型

类别 代表产品 主要功能
操作系统 Ubuntu Server、CentOS、Windows Server 提供基础运行环境
控制面板 cPanel、Plesk、宝塔面板 可视化服务器管理
应用环境 LAMP、LNMP、WAMP Web服务套件
管理工具 Webmin、Virtualmin 系统管理辅助

详细安装操作流程

步骤一:选择操作系统安装包

操作说明:根据业务需求选择合适的操作系统安装包 使用工具提示:VPS提供商控制面板、ISO镜像文件
# 查看可用系统镜像列表
Available Systems:
  1. Ubuntu 22.04 LTS
  2. CentOS 9 Stream
  3. Debian 11
  4. Windows Server 2022
  5. AlmaLinux 9

步骤二:安装控制面板

操作说明:安装服务器管理控制面板简化操作 使用工具提示:SSH终端、命令行工具
# 安装宝塔面板示例
wget -O install.sh http://download.bt.cn/install/install-ubuntu_6.0.sh
sudo bash install.sh

步骤三:配置应用环境

操作说明:部署LAMP或LNMP等Web服务环境 使用工具提示:面板软件商店、一键安装脚本
# 手动安装LNMP环境
sudo apt update
sudo apt install nginx mysql-server php-fpm

步骤四:安装必要组件

操作说明:根据业务需求安装额外组件和扩展 使用工具提示:包管理器、编译工具
# Ubuntu安装常用组件
sudo apt install curl git zip unzip
sudo apt install php-mysql php-curl php-gd

常见问题及解决方案

问题 原因 解决方案
安装过程中断 网络不稳定或资源不足 检查网络连接,确保VPS配置满足要求
系统无法启动 镜像文件损坏或配置错误 重新下载系统镜像,检查启动参数
面板登录失败 防火墙阻止或服务未启动 开放相应端口,重启面板服务
环境配置冲突 多个软件版本不兼容 卸载冲突软件,使用统一版本
性能问题 资源分配不足或配置不当 优化系统配置,升级硬件资源

选择建议

在选择VPS系统安装包时,需要考虑业务需求、技术栈兼容性、维护成本等因素。Linux系统通常更适合Web服务,而Windows Server则更适合.NET框架应用。控制面板能大幅降低管理难度,特别适合初学者使用。 对于不同的使用场景,推荐以下组合:
  • 个人博客/网站:Ubuntu + 宝塔面板 + LNMP
  • 企业应用:CentOS + Plesk + 定制环境
  • 开发测试:Debian + Webmin + LAMP
通过合理选择和配置系统安装包,可以快速搭建稳定高效的服务器环境,满足各种业务需求。

发表评论

评论列表